MLK Day Services Scheduled In Chattooga County

Dr. Martin Luther King, Jr. Day will be celebrated this year on Monday, January 20, 2020.  The national holiday is often marked as a “day of service” to the community and people are encouraged to remember the legacy of Dr. King by volunteering time for a local charitable cause.

Free Classes For Those Concerned About Falling

The Chattooga County Library Summerville Branch will be offering free classes for older adults who have concerns about falling and as a result, restrict their activities.  “A Matter Of Balance” is an award-winning, eight-week program that emphasizes practical strategies designed to manage falls and increase activity levels.  The class will start January 7th and will be held from 8:30-10:30 AM at the Summerville Branch of the Chattooga County Library.  Sign up is required.  You can contact 706-857-2553 for more information.  Also you can find more information below:
